2009 Malware Attacks Rise Alarmingly

Virus research firm Panda Labs reports that more than 25 million new malware strains were created last year.

The security vendor's Annual Malware Report outlines this alarming number which far exceeds the 15 million malware versions identified in the past 20 years.

66 percent of the new malware specimens constitute banking trojans, which attempt to access banking information and data from your computer.

The next most popular category were scareware, also known as fake antivirus software, which attempt to alarm you into downloading "Antivirus" software that detects a virus on your machine, then charges you to 'fix' the infection.  These fake software often open your computer to additional malware and virus' and should be avoided or removed immediately.
